Cartogiraffe.com

Hicks Avenue

Hicks Avenue is an asphalted street with two lanes in Medford. In the area there is a bus stop.

Pin to show location on the map Hicks Avenue

type of road
Secondary road
Lanes
2
Bus stop
Opp 326 Mystic Ave